1. The Rise of Interactive and Immersive Web Series:
One of the most significant trends will be the expansion of interactive and immersive web series experiences. Viewers will no longer be passive observers but active participants in the narrative.
-

Interactive Storytelling: Expect to see more “choose your own adventure” style web series where viewers’ decisions directly impact the plot and character development. Platforms will leverage branching narratives and interactive elements embedded within the video stream, allowing viewers to influence the storyline through polls, quizzes, and decision-making prompts. Companies like Netflix have already experimented with this format, but by 2025, interactive narratives will become far more sophisticated and commonplace, driven by improved interactive video technology and authoring tools.
-
VR/AR Integration: Virtual and augmented reality technologies will find increasing application in web series. Viewers might use VR headsets to experience scenes from a web series from a first-person perspective or use AR apps to overlay interactive elements onto their physical environment while watching. This will create highly immersive and engaging experiences, blurring the lines between entertainment and reality. Imagine watching a sci-fi web series and seeing holographic projections of characters appearing in your living room.
-
Gamification: Gamification elements, such as points, badges, and leaderboards, will be integrated into web series to encourage viewer participation and create a sense of community. Viewers might earn points for correctly answering trivia questions about the series, contributing to fan theories, or sharing content on social media. These gamified experiences will foster deeper engagement and loyalty among viewers.
2. The Dominance of Short-Form Video and Micro-Series:
While longer-form web series will still exist, short-form video and micro-series are predicted to gain even more traction. This trend is driven by the increasing popularity of platforms like T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ube Shorts, where attention spans are shorter and content consumption is highly mobile.
-
Vertical Video Optimization: Web series will be increasingly optimized for vertical video formats, catering to mobile viewing habits. This means not just resizing existing content but also conceiving and producing series specifically for vertical screens, utilizing dynamic editing techniques and close-up shots to maintain viewer engagement.
-
Episodic Bites: Expect to see more web series structured as a collection of short, self-contained episodes, each lasting only a few minutes. These “episodic bites” will be perfect for on-the-go viewing and easy sharing on social media platforms.
-
Micro-Narratives: The art of crafting compelling narratives in extremely short formats will become increasingly important. Web series creators will need to master the skill of telling complete stories with minimal dialogue and maximum visual impact. This will require a focus on concise storytelling, impactful visuals, and clever editing.

4. The Evolution of Monetization Strategies:
Traditional advertising models are becoming less effective, and web series creators will need to explore new and innovative monetization strategies to sustain their work.
-
Direct-to-Fan Funding: Platforms like Patreon and Kickstarter will become increasingly important for web series creators. Direct-to-fan funding allows creators to bypass traditional gatekeepers and build direct relationships with their audiences, who can support their work through subscriptions, donations, and crowdfunding campaigns.
-
Branded Content and Product Placement: Branded content and product placement will become more sophisticated and integrated into the narrative. Instead of simply inserting products into scenes, creators will work with brands to create seamless and authentic integrations that enhance the viewing experience.
-
NFTs and Blockchain Technology: Non-fungible tokens (NFTs) and blockchain technology will offer new opportunities for web series creators to monetize their work. Creators can sell NFTs of behind-the-scenes content, exclusive merchandise, or even ownership stakes in their web series. Blockchain technology can also be used to create decentralized distribution platforms, allowing creators to retain more control over their content and revenue.
-
Subscription Bundling: Expect to see more platforms offering bundled subscriptions that include access to a variety of web series and other digital content. This will provide viewers with a convenient and affordable way to discover new web series and support independent creators.

6. The Rise of AI-Generated Content (With a Caveat):
While AI is poised to assist in various aspects of web series production, the complete AI-generated web series is unlikely to be a dominant force by 2025. AI can assist with scriptwriting, generating visuals, and even composing music, but the human element of storytelling, emotional depth, and nuanced character development will remain crucial.
-
AI as a Tool, Not a Replacement: AI will be used primarily as a tool to augment human creativity, not to replace it entirely. AI can help creators brainstorm ideas, generate drafts, and automate repetitive tasks, but the final product will still require human input and artistic vision.
-
Ethical Considerations: The use of AI in content creation raises ethical considerations, such as copyright ownership and the potential for bias. The industry will need to develop guidelines and best practices to ensure that AI is used responsibly and ethically.
-
The Search for Authenticity: Viewers are increasingly seeking out authentic and relatable content. While AI can generate technically proficient content, it often lacks the emotional depth and human connection that viewers crave.
